This text is aimed at policy makers and decision makers in the public and private health sectors. It does not prescribe what actions to take, but recognizes that each country is unique with its own history, internal priorities, available resources, and political ideology, and therefore encourages the reader to identify their own healthcare strategy. The book tackles key issues such as: what should the roles of public and private sectors be?; how can the objectives of the for-profit private sector be expanded to include national health objectives?; what degree of control and regulation is needed with regard to the quality and pricing of services?; what are the effects of different payment mechanisms?; what is the most appropriate role of government?; and what are the impacts on equity and national development?
